Tracing your family tree is the process of researching and documenting the lineage of your ancestors. This can be done by gathering information from various sources such as birth, marriage, and death certificates, census records, and other historical documents.
Joining an Online Genealogy Forum
Joining an online genealogy forum is a great way to connect with other genealogy enthusiasts, share information, and receive support and guidance as you research your family history. Genealogy forums are online communities where members can post questions, share information, and collaborate on research projects.
